Amber like material in exhaust
Ok, this one is baffling. I just pulled both my 525EFI's for some winter work and both, including the one rebuilt last spring have a bit of amber like material in the exhaust ports of the heads. I searched around online and found a few other people with the same thing, but no answers on what it is. Maybe something from the fuel? Anyone have any ideas???
